From Breakingviews - Breakingviews - A bad bank for Hong Kong is far from unthinkable reut.rs/3TLWdrz
Breakingviews - A bad bank for Hong Kong is far from unthinkable
Regulators dismissed reports that lenders mulled creating a structure to take on their problem debt. But asset sales by weaker developers will up the strain on smaller banks, and an extended slump could put a third of the city's $180 bln of commercial real estate loans at risk.
